Abstract

Sebagai respon terhadap dinamika perekonomian yang terus berkembang dan komitmen pemerintah untuk meningkatkan iklim investasi, Indonesia memperkenalkan sistem Online Single Submission Risk-Based Approach (OSS RBA) untuk perizinan berusaha. Penelitian yang dilakukan di Provinsi Sumatera Selatan ini menggunakan Unified Theory of Acceptance and Use of Technology II (UTAUT II) dan Model DeLone and McLean untuk menilai kepuasan pengguna dan keberhasilan sistem dalam implementasi OSS RBA. Penelitian ini menggunakan teknik PLS-SEM pada software smartpls 4.0 sebagai model penelitian, menggunakan pendekatan kuantitatif melalui kuesioner berskala Likert. Penelitian ini difokuskan pada pelaku usaha di Sumsel yang mendaftarkan izin usahanya di platform OSS RBA, dimana terdapat 41.129 usaha yang menyelesaikan pendaftaran pada tahun 2022. Sesuai dengan kriteria pengambilan sampel, maka besar sampel ditetapkan sebanyak 276 sampel untuk menjamin kredibilitas, menyeimbangkan jumlah parameter dan indikator untuk variabel laten, sebanyak 25 indikator yang ada.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a Performance Expectancy, Price Value, System Quality, dan Service Quality berpengaruh signifikan terhadap User Satisfaction, selanjutnya User Satisfaction berpengaruh signifikan terhadap Net Benefit. Sebaliknya Effort Expectancy, Social Influence, dan Information Quality tidak berpengaruh signifikan terhadap kepuasan pengguna. Wawasan ini memberikan pemahaman komprehensif tentang perizinan berusaha yang berkembang di Provinsi Sumatera Selatan.

In response to evolving economic dynamics and the government's commitment to enhance the investment climate, Indonesia introduced the Online Submission Risk-Based Approach (OSS RBA) system for business licensing. This research, conducted in South Sumatra Province, employs the Unified Theory of Acceptance and Use of Technology II (UTAUT II) and the Delone and McLean Model to assess user satisfaction and system success in the OSS RBA implementation. This study utilized PLS-SEM technique in smartpls 4.0 software to model the research, employing a quantitative approach through Likert-scale questionnaires. The research focused on business actors in South Sumatra who registered their permits on the OSS RBA platform, where 41,129 businesses completed registration in 2022. Adhering to sampling criteria, the sample size was set at 276 samples to ensure credibility, balancing the number of parameters and indicators for latent variables, as 25 indicators were present. This research findings reveal that Performance Expectancy, Price Value, System Quality, and Service Quality significantly influence User Satisfaction, subsequently User Satisfaction significantly influence Net Benefit. Conversely, Effort Expectancy, Social Influence, and Information Quality do not significantly affect User Satisfaction. These insights provide a comprehensive understanding of the evolving business licensing in South Sumatera Province.
